Common Causes of Post Delays

There could be various factors contributing to post delays:

  • Royal Mail system issues
  • Unexpected volume of mail
  • Weather conditions affecting transportation
  • Technical glitches in sorting facilities
  • Incorrect addresses or incomplete postage

Addressing Royal Mail Delivery Problems

To tackle issues with Royal Mail delivery, consider these steps:

  1. Contact Royal Mail customer service to inquire about your missing post.
  2. Check for any service alerts or updates on postal delays.
  3. Ensure your address details are accurate and complete.
  4. Track your mail using any available tracking services.
  5. Consider alternative delivery options if urgent.

Why am I experiencing delays in receiving my post from Royal Mail?

There could be various reasons for delays in receiving post from Royal Mail. Factors such as high volume of mail, adverse weather conditions, technical issues, or staffing shortages can all contribute to delays in postal delivery. Its also possible that your specific area is experiencing localized delays due to logistical challenges or operational issues.

How can I track my post if I suspect there may be delivery problems with Royal Mail?

If you suspect there may be delivery problems with Royal Mail, you can track your post using the tracking number provided on your postage receipt or shipping confirmation. By entering the tracking number on the Royal Mail website or using their tracking app, you can get real-time updates on the status and location of your mail. This can help you identify any potential delays or issues in the delivery process.

What should I do if I am consistently not receiving any post from Royal Mail?

If you are consistently not receiving any post from Royal Mail, it is advisable to contact Royal Mail customer service to report the issue. They can investigate the matter further, provide information on any known delays or disruptions in your area, and offer assistance in resolving the issue. Its also a good idea to check with your local post office or delivery office to see if there are any specific reasons for the lack of mail delivery to your address.
